Good afternoon,
Information Systems is pleased to announce support for MacZephyr 
1.5.2, the latest version of the Macintosh client for the zephyr 
protocol, a real-time messaging and notification system used by MIT 
students, staff and faculty. MacZephyr can also be used to 
communicate with users at other institutions with a zephyr 
infrastructure.


New Features in MacZephyr 1.5.2
-------------------------------
- Runs natively on Mac OS X (10.2 or later)
- Can send a zephyr message to multiple recipients
- Open URL command for opening URLs received in zephyr messages
- Can specify fonts for the list and messages windows
- Improved support for communicating with zephyr users in other realms

For more new features, see 
http://web.mit.edu/is/help/maczephyr/features-osx.html.

Who Should Upgrade and Why
--------------------------
Users who are using MacZephyr 1.3.4 (or earlier) in Mac OS X's 
Classic environment should upgrade to MacZephyr 1.5.2, as it runs 
natively on Mac OS X 10.2 or later. Users of Mac OS X 10.1 or Mac OS 
9.2.2 (or earlier) should continue to use MacZephyr 1.3.4.
